There's nothing better than coming home after a long day and standing under a hot shower, letting the day wash away. It's even better if you're showering in a beautiful, up-to-date bathroom. Breathing new life into your bathroom doesn't have to mean a complete reno; there are plenty of simple updates you can make to keep your bathroom looking great.

If your budget for updates is small, consider bringing in new shower accessories. Mira Showers has a huge range of the latest shower accessories, including eco-friendly showerheads. These showerheads can save up to 85% of water, so you can reduce your carbon footprint and still have a great, refreshing shower.

If you have a bit more money to invest, a shower tray is the perfect addition to anyone's bathroom. They come in a range of sizes and they also include BioCote, which helps reduce bacteria and mould growth, so you'll know your bathroom is as fresh and clean as it can be.

If you really want to transform your bathroom, consider replacing your shower altogether. A sleek mixer shower will give your bathroom a chic and modern look, with a perfect showering experience for you. Or, for an amazing shower every time you jump in, try a brand new electric shower.

via

Just like everything else, bathrooms and showers go in and out of style. Upgrading their look good can be done on any budget and your investment will raise the re-sale value of your home, too.

Rustic vintage décor is a popular trend in design right now. Natural materials like stone and reclaimed woods are mixed with vintage cabin, farmhouse and even modern styles to create the charming rustic vintage décor we're seeing in shelter magazines and on design blogs. Rustic cabin style is having a bit of a renaissance in design right now. Mixed with other styles like vintage, modern and even contemporary, rustic elements are trending hot right now. Even taxidermy.

Rustic and vintage elements fill this new kitchen with charm befitting a 19th century homestead. Recycled wood beams add a rustic feel while accessories like the hanging lantern add vintage charm.

A popular way of adding a rustic feeling to a room is by using antlers as decorative elements.  Hung on walls or displayed in cabinets, antlers add a natural element to a room. This dining room features vintage lighting as well as a vintage bookcase used as a china cabinet.
